Güven Tezcan is a Director at FenwayXn and a delay expert specialising in forensic analysis for high-value international construction disputes. Over his career, he has worked across the UK, Europe, the Middle East, Hong Kong, and Turkey, advising on sectors including rail, aviation, high-rise developments, renewable energy, oil & gas, heavy civil engineering, and residential projects.
Güven began his career as a planning engineer on a 100,600 m² airport terminal project in Riyadh, Saudi Arabia, before becoming a senior planning engineer on a major airport modernisation programme in Bahrain, delivering a 222,000 m² terminal and supporting facilities. He has since contributed to a wide range of landmark infrastructure projects, including power plants, water distribution systems, and complex residential developments.
He has advised on multi-billion-pound disputes and pre-dispute strategies, producing forensic delay analyses and independent expert evidence under arbitration and adjudication proceedings. Güven holds an MSc in Construction Law & Dispute Resolution from King’s College London, an MSc in Construction Management, and a BSc in Civil Engineering from Boğaziçi University, Turkey. He is a Fellow of the Chartered Institute of Arbitrators, a certified Project Management Professional®, and author of an article on concurrent delay published in the Construction Law Journal.
